Edward II is one the most talked about kings of England, but not for his bravery or his great accomplishments. Instead we have been told for centuries that it was a 'red-hot poker' that was his end.
Historian Kathryn Warner joins us today to debunk the myths and to answer listener submitted questions.
Also, by pure coincidence, our guest today also mentions Agnes Strickland's incorrect history on Edward II as well.
